-1

私はJavaFX2.0アプリケーションに取り組んでおり、Webサイトとそのコンテンツを詳細に保存したいのですが、これを行う方法がわかりません。たとえば、深さ0が必要な場合は、最初のhtmlページが保存されます。深さが1の場合、Webサイトの最初のhtmlページとそのすべてのサブページをコンテンツとともに保存します。私はこれを行う方法がわかりません。

私はこのプロジェクトを宿題として持っています。私は学生です!

誰でもここで私を助けることができますか?私はとても素晴らしいです。

どうもありがとう!

4

1 に答える 1

3

JavaFXにこのタスク用の特別なAPIがあるかどうかはわかりません。javaFXの主なアイデアは、「本当にクールなGUIを構築するためのツール」として定義できますが、「Web上の特定のタスクのための特別なツール」とは異なります。たぶん、WebViewコンポーネントはあなたのタスクを助けることができます(その目的はWebでの作業であるため)。そうでない場合は、他のフレームワークを使用する場合と同じように、このタスクでjavaFXを使用する必要があります。HTMLページ用に独自のパーサーを作成します(Webサイトを文字列として読み取り、すべてのhtmlタグを見つけるために解析します。 。など...XPathはそこであなたを助けることができます)、またはいくつかの既存のライブラリを見つけてアプリケーションでそれらを使用します。したがって、javaFXは、GUIを構築するためのフレームワークとしてこのプロジェクトで役立ちますが、ビジネスロジックは他のいくつかのフレームワークで実行する必要があります。

于 2012-04-25T13:12:07.760 に答える